“14 For sin shall not have dominion over you: for you are not under the law, but under Grace.
15 What then? shall we sin, because we are not under the law, but under Grace? God forbid.” Romans 6:14-15
We either believe the Word of God to be true or we believe It to be a lie. If we believe that by Grace through faith we are given dominion over sin, we believe the Word of God to be true. Many are walking on the sidelines of Christiandom because sin, whatever that sin may be, has dominion over them. In their hearts they feel inferior to the self righteous because whose sin they cannot see because it is, well…self righteousness. Let me be clear, self righteousness and condemnation by a professing Christian will not lead the sinner or the bound to repentance.
Simply stated, if the Believer does not believe the redeeming work of Jesus Christ on Calvary’s Cross (Grace) broke the power of sin in their hearts and lives, they believe the Word of God to be a lie.
“For Christ sent me not to baptize, but to preach the Gospel: not with wisdom of words, lest the Cross of Christ should be made of none effect.” 1 Corinthians 1:17
Man made laws from humanistic psychology are nothing more than wisdom of words that make the Cross of Christ of no effect. 12 steps of celebrating recovery, 40 days of purpose or 100 days of favor will not give the Believer dominion over sin. If we believe this, we believe the Word of God to be a lie and the Cross of Christ was in vain.
On Calvary’s Cross Jesus Christ redeemed man to God. His redeeming work IS the power of God to Save the sinner and Sanctify the Saint. Before our Salvation, when we were still a sinner, we did not have the power within ourselves to willingly yield ourselves unto God. The lost are spiritually dead and not alive (spiritually) unto God. They are not lost because they reject Jesus but reject Jesus because they are lost.
However, for the Child of God who remains in bondage, sin has dominion over them in some way, the condemnation from the religious and self righteous too often keep the bound from yielding themselves unto God as servants of obedience unto righteousness. They feel like they must perfect themselves before yielding unto God. Friend, Brother, Sister – you can’t. Sin will continue it’s dominion until we yield unto God.
“Know you not, that to whom you yield yourselves servants to obey, his servants you are to whom you obey; whether of sin unto death, or of obedience unto righteousness?” Romans 6:16
Please allow me to repeat this simple yet powerful Truth. Before Salvation, we are not able to willingly yield unto God as servants of obedience unto righteousness. If such were so, the Cross of Christ was in vain. Through His Work on the Cross, Jesus Christ made a way for us to yield unto God…to partake in HIS Divine Nature and allow us to be His servants of obedience unto righteousness.
“Whereby are given unto us exceeding great and precious promises: that by these you might be partakers of the Divine Nature, having escaped the corruption that is in the world through lust.” 2 Peter 1:4
